Gloucester City Fire Marshall Explains Fire Pit Regulations

CNBNews NOTE: Recently a Gloucester City resident submitted a Letter to the Editor titled Concerned Resident Worried about Fire Pits Causing a Fire. Gloucester City Fire Marshall Patrick Hagan responds to the resident\’s letter in the statement below.
 
It was brought to my attention that a City resident was wondering about Fire Pit regulations. The City of Gloucester City does have regulations against Fire Pits and as well as the handling of BBQ and LPG (Propane) Grills which falls under the New Jersey Fire Code sections N.J.A.C. 5:70:307 and 308.
  1. If a resident wishes to have an open fire \”bonfire\” they are required to receive a permit from the Bureau of Fire Prevention at the Gloucester Fire Department, which then an Inspection would be conducted.
  2. If a resident wishes to use a \”fire pit\” in an approved container there are restrictions with these too. The distance for this is 15 feet from any structure. NO PERMIT needed because it is in an approved container.
  3. If a resident wishes to use a BBQ or LP-gas grill it shall not be stored or used under the following circumstances:
  1. On any porch, balcony or any other portion of the building
  2. Within any room or space of a building
  3. Within 5 feet of any combustible exterior wall
  4. Within, 5 feet, vertically or horizontally, of an opening in any wall; or
  5. Under any building overhang
EXCEPTION: detached one or two family dwelling
(This exception means: If you live in a Twin, Row, or Apartment Building you must follow this code; however, Single family dwellings are exempt from this.)

NJDOT begins emergency repairs on Route 55 bridges in Cumberland County

 

Cracks found on 10 bridges to be fixed

(Trenton) – New Jersey Department of Transportation (NJDOT) officials announced that repairs would begin today to 10 bridges on Route 55 in Millville and Vineland in Cumberland County.

As part of the statewide bridge inspection ordered by Commissioner Jamie Fox, NJDOT crews discovered cracks that necessitated emergency repairs at more than 200 locations on the 10 bridges. The work will require lane closures during the day and evening hours.

Twin Peaks Company Revokes Franchise For Waco Restaurant After Biker Brawl/CNBNews.net

 

 

The Twin Peaks company revoked the franchise agreement for its Waco, Texas, restaurant Monday after the biker-gang shootout there Sunday that left nine dead. Waco investigators blamed the restaurant\’s management for ignoring the police department\’s advice to ban biker gangs.
